Overview of the Data
The Center for Research in Security Prices U.S. stock database contains a comprehensive collection of financial market data, including price, return, and volume data for the NYSE, AMEX and Nasdaq stock markets.

Once you have access to the datasets, data can be pulled using packaged CRSP software such as tsPrint and stkPrint, or by using Fortran or C. To have the packaged CRSP software installed on your computer, email the Data Czar with a simple request to have CRSP software installed.

Once tsPrint is installed, a simple tutorial on pulling data using this application can be found here. tsPrint is an easily learned, user-friendly application that is good for pulling data for a few securities for simple analysis. For more complicated research projects where multiple data items are needed for multiple securities, it may be better to access the data using a FORTRAN or C program.
